AIOps, or Artificial Intelligence for IT Operations, is an essential advancement in IT management due to its advanced software solutions. The software element plays a crucial role in AIOps by utilizing sophisticated methods to boost efficiency, reduce manual duties, and improve IT operations.As you read further, this article will offer additional information on the components of AIOps, its key features, benefits, challenges, and potential opportunities ahead.
What is AIOps Software?
AIOps employs Artificial Intelligence (AI) and Machine Learning (ML) to automate and enhance IT operations, serving as a more sophisticated type of software. The objective of this software is to minimize manual labor, lessen downtime, and enhance IT operations through the application of AI-driven analysis and automation. AIOps software revolutionizes IT operations management through the utilization of artificial intelligence. Big data analytics is used to examine vast amounts of data generated in different IT settings. AIOps tools analyze system logs, performance metrics, and network traffic data to predict problems before they escalate. AIOps software uses machine learning algorithms to identify patterns and anomalies, indicating possible issues and allowing for proactive measures. Automation of routine IT tasks is a key function of AIOps software. Therefore, the software component of AIOps includes a collection of applications and utilities that assist in utilizing AI and ML methods to improve IT operations.This consists of:
- Data Aggregation and Integration: A software that gathers and combines information from different IT systems and sources such as logs, metrics, and events.
- Analytics and Machine Learning: Applications utilizing AI and ML algorithms to analyze data, detect anomalies, spot patterns, predict problems, and conduct root cause analysis.
- Automation and Orchestration: Tools that streamline IT operations by automating responses to identified issues and coordinating tasks and workflows.
- Visualization and Reporting: Interfaces that offer dashboards and reports for IT teams to visualize system health, performance trends, and insights gained from data.
- Integration with IT Systems:Software that works with current IT infrastructure and tools to guarantee smooth operation and data flow.
Essentially, the software part of AIOps includes all the technological elements and features that support advanced data analysis, automation, and operational efficiency in IT settings.
Key Features of AIOps Software
Integration of AI and Machine Learning
AI imitates human thinking and problem-solving, machine learning (ML) teaches algorithms to find patterns by training data. Some of these technologies, individually and collectively driving improvements in software through process automation to help reduce errors while enhancing decision-making. AI and ML help the software to become intelligent and user-friendly, which is very important for IT operations these days.
Collecting and Analyzing Data
AIOps depends on gathering and examining extensive amounts of data from diverse origins. AI algorithms analyze this data to identify patterns and correlations that human analysts could overlook. This ability assists organizations in predicting issues, identifying fresh dangers, and making better decisions using detailed data insights.
Benefits of AIOps
Enhanced Collaboration and Efficiency
AIOps breaks down data silos and fosters better communication among IT teams, even across different locations. This increased collaboration improves overall efficiency and effectiveness.
Optimized IT Infrastructure
AIOps guarantees efficient operation of customer-facing applications by monitoring and optimizing IT infrastructure. Assisting in resolving problems such as network congestion and ineffective resource distribution improves the overall user experience.
Faster and More Accurate Root Cause Analysis
AIOps stands out in pinpointing the underlying reasons for IT problems, leading to a decrease in the time required to solve issues. By examining occurrences and their consequences, AIOps facilitates faster and more precise incident resolution.
Proactive Anomaly Detection
AIOps platforms use machine learning algorithms to constantly observe data and identify abnormalities. This proactive strategy enables organizations to handle possible issues before they escalate into significant challenges.
Practical Cases Network Tracking and Enhancement
Network tracking involves monitoring data movement within a network to improve performance, security, and resource management. Key benefits include:
- Improving performance: Identifying and resolving network congestion and inefficiencies.
- Effective allocation of resources: Enhancing bandwidth and resource allocation.
- Security Analysis: Detecting unusual activity and potential security threats.
- Enhanced Performance and Security:Enhancing user experience and bolstering network defenses through ongoing monitoring.
Application Performance Management (APM)
APM entails overseeing and controlling software application performance and accessibility by designing, supervising, improving, assessing, and incentivizing to ensure they meet performance criteria.
Challenges and Considerations Building Trust and Reliability
One major challenge with AIOps is establishing trust in its decisions and recommendations, especially during initial implementation. To overcome this, effective communication and training are essential for gaining user trust.
Increasing IT Complexity
As IT systems become more complex, integrating various data types and sources can be challenging. AIOps helps by correlating and contextualizing data to make it more actionable.
Data Overload
Organizations generate massive amounts of data from numerous sources. AIOps must handle this data efficiently to detect and resolve issues at a detailed level, where many network problems first appear.
Future Directions for AIOps
In the upcoming years, AIOps is anticipated to have a big impact on security tasks like detecting threats, anomalies, and monitoring compliance. By integrating these features, AIOps can aid companies in reducing cybersecurity risks and improving the robustness and effectiveness of their IT systems. AIOps is revolutionizing IT operations through improved automation, effectiveness, and decision-making. Although there are difficulties, the potential to transform IT management means it is a key area for organizations to prioritize in the future.
In summary, AIOps software represents a transformative shift in IT operations and software development. By harnessing the power of AI, organizations can achieve more efficient and proactive management of their IT infrastructure, ultimately leading to improved performance, reduced downtime, and enhanced innovation.